# How to Integrate Stamped.io with Daton

### Prerequisites

Before starting, ensure you have an active Daton and Stamped.io account.

### Task &#x31;**: Generate API Access Keys** for your Stamped.io account

* Log in to your [Stamped.io ](https://stamped.io/)account and navigate to the **API Keys** section and click it.&#x20;

* Your API Key Id, Key Secret, and Store Hash will appear on your screen. Save the credentials as they will be used during Stamped.io integration with Daton.

### **Task 2:** ​Integrate Daton with Stamped.io Account

1. Log in to your [Daton account](https://daton.sarasanalytics.com/u/integrations-list) and search for Stamped.io in the list of Connectors, then click **Configure**.
2. Enter the following details and click **Authenticate**:&#x20;

   * Integration Name&#x20;
   * Replication Frequency&#x20;
   * Replication Start Date&#x20;

   **Note** that the Integration Name will be used to create the integration tables and cannot be modified later.
3. Provide the following Stamped.io credentials to **authenticate** the integration:

   * API Key Id
   * API Key Secret
   * Store Hash

4. After successful authentication, you will be prompted to choose from the list of available tables. Select the required tables and click **Next.**  <br>

5. Select the required fields for each table and click **Submit.**&#x20;

   **Note** that you will be prompted to select the destination for your account.
6. Select the destination for your store or shop and click **Confirm**. An integration successful message will be displayed.

## Important Note

* Integrations would begin in the Pending state and change to the Active state once the first job successfully loaded data into the configured warehouse.&#x20;
* Users can check job status and process logs from the integration details page by clicking on the integration name in the active list.&#x20;
* Users can Re-Authenticate, Edit, Clone, Pause, or Delete the integration at any moment by clicking on settings. You can also adjust the frequency and history of the integration.&#x20;
* On the Sources page, click Integration to access each table in your integration. The page also shows the state of each table, the last replicated time, and Reload access buttons.&#x20;
